Side-by-Side Comparison

Feature Stasi stasis
Definition The Ministry for State Security, secret police and intelligence organization of the German Democratic Republic (East Germany). A slackening or arrest of the blood current, due not to a lessening of the heart’s beat, but to some abnormal resistance of the capillary walls.

Spelling & Dictionary Insight

These two trip readers on the page rather than in the ear: Stasi is /ˈstɑːzi/ while stasis is /ˈsteɪsɪs/. Spoken aloud the problem disappears. In writing it persists, because they differ by 1 extra letter(s) - “Stasi” sits inside “stasis”, and the parts of speech differ too (name vs noun), which is usually the fastest check.
